Search results

  1. S

    Any idea when Michelin Defender 2 goes on sale?

    My 2009 Honda Odyssey needs new tires. I mean, it's probably needed new tires for a while, but the right rear has a slow leak that has me topping it off about every other day, so it's really time to get new tires. I normally buy them at Costco, which is where I got the X-Tour A/S T+H the wheels...